Materials and Finishes

The cornerstone of the modern dark wood kitchen is its use of high-quality, dark-stained hardwoods. Popular choices include walnut, mahogany, and cherry, each offering rich, deep hues that exude luxury. These woods are often treated with finishes that enhance their natural grain, adding a layer of depth and texture to the cabinetry and furniture. Matte and satin finishes are particularly favored, as they provide a sleek, understated sheen that complements modern design sensibilities.

Design Elements

A key characteristic of the modern dark wood kitchen is its streamlined, minimalist design. Clean lines and uncluttered surfaces are paramount, creating an elegant, orderly environment. Cabinetry is typically handle-free, employing push-to-open mechanisms or recessed handles to maintain a seamless look. Open shelving and glass-fronted cabinets are also common, allowing for the display of curated kitchenware and adding a sense of openness to the space.

The color palette in these kitchens is deliberately restrained, with dark wood tones often juxtaposed against neutral or monochromatic backgrounds. White, gray, and black are popular choices for walls, countertops, and backsplashes, creating a striking contrast that highlights the beauty of the wood. Additionally, metallic accents, such as brushed nickel or matte black fixtures, can introduce a modern industrial touch.

Functional Advantages

Beyond aesthetics, the modern dark wood kitchen offers several practical benefits. Dark wood is notably durable and resistant to wear, making it an excellent choice for high-traffic areas like the kitchen. Its ability to conceal minor scratches and stains also contributes to its longevity and ease of maintenance.

Moreover, the thoughtful design of these kitchens often includes innovative storage solutions. Pull-out pantries, deep drawers, and custom inserts help maximize space and keep the kitchen organized. The integration of modern appliances, often built-in to maintain the clean lines of the cabinetry, ensures that the kitchen is not only beautiful but also highly functional.
